Open My Account Settings

Step 1: Log in to your Teacher Portal HERE.

Step 2: Hover over your name in the top right corner, then click Account.

Pro-Tip: Clicking your name goes straight to My Account Settings without opening the menu.

Update Your Personal Info

Your Personal Info: The left-hand card on My Account Settings holds your Email, Nickname, First Name, Last Name, Phone and Time Zone. Update Personal Info stays grayed out until you change something; click it to save.

Pro-Tip: If the Email field is grayed out, you sign in with Google, Clever, ClassLink or Microsoft, and that provider owns your email address. To take it back, submit a request to remove the SSO at support@typing.com.

Update Your Organization Details

Organization Details: The right-hand card holds your organization's name - School Name or District Name, depending on your account type - and its address and phone number. Changes here apply to every teacher in the same organization. Click Update Organization to save. If you don't see this card, a school or district administrator controls those details.

Note: Replacing the Typing.com logo with your school or district logo is a PLUS feature. Without PLUS the uploader is still on the card, grayed out and badged PLUS Feature.

Change Your Password

Change Your Password: At the bottom of the Your Personal Info card, under a label reading Password, click Change Your Password. This is only on accounts that sign in with a Typing.com email and password - if you sign in with Google, Clever, ClassLink or Microsoft, change your password with that provider instead.

The window that opens is headed Change Your Password and asks for Current Password, New Password and New Password Again. Click Update Password to save.

Note: If you are unable to change your password, you can submit a request at support@typing.com.

Convert Your Account Type

Your current account type is at the top of My Account Settings: Account Type reads Classroom, School or District, and Current License reads PLUS Account or Free - Ad Supported.

Convert Your Account: A Classroom account can become a School or District account from this page. Click Change to School or District Account beside Account Type, then pick a column in the Account Types window and click Convert to School Account for Free or Convert to District Account for Free. On a School account the link reads Change to District Account. Converting only goes upwards: once you are on a District account there is nothing bigger to move to.

Note: To change the role of your account (Teacher, School Admin, District Admin, Billing Admin) you will need to send an email to support@typing.com to make the change. 

Account Types:

  • Classroom: Unlimited classes and unlimited students, with one teacher - you.

  • School: Everything a Classroom account has, plus unlimited teachers and unlimited school administrators. After converting you can invite other teachers and administrators - they must have a Typing.com account before you can add them. You keep every class, student and record you already had.

  • District: Everything a School account has, plus unlimited schools and unlimited district administrators. You keep every class, student and record you already had.

Pro-Tip: If you need to add co-teachers to your classes, you need to have a School or District account.
